#71591f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71591f is composed of 44.3% red, 34.9%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.2% magenta, 72.6%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 42.4 degrees, a saturation of 56.9% and a lightness of 28.2%. #71591f color hex could be obtained by blending #e2b23e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#71591f color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#71591f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#71591f has RGB values of R:113, G:89, B:31 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.73,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7428383.
